- sybaritic - Wiktionary, the free dictionary
sybaritic (comparative more sybaritic, superlative most sybaritic) Of or having the qualities of a sybarite (“a person devoted to luxury and pleasure ”); dedicated to excessive comfort and enjoyment; decadent, hedonistic, self-indulgent Synonyms: epicurean, lotus-eating, sybarite, (archaic) sybaritical; see also Thesaurus: hedonistic
